About

Yao‐Shen Chen is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Virology and Infectious Diseases. According to data from OpenAlex, Yao‐Shen Chen has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 328 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Epidemiology, 2 papers in Virology and 2 papers in Infectious Diseases. Recurrent topics in Yao‐Shen Chen’s work include Burkholderia infections and melioidosis (3 papers), HIV Research and Treatment (2 papers) and Infective Endocarditis Diagnosis and Management (1 paper). Yao‐Shen Chen is often cited by papers focused on Burkholderia infections and melioidosis (3 papers), HIV Research and Treatment (2 papers) and Infective Endocarditis Diagnosis and Management (1 paper). Yao‐Shen Chen collaborates with scholars based in Taiwan and United States. Yao‐Shen Chen's co-authors include Yung‐Ching Liu, Shue‐Ren Wann, Hsi‐Hsun Lin, Chun‐Kai Huang, Susan Shin‐Jung Lee, Hung‐Chin Tsai, Chien‐Ching Hung, Wen‐Chien Ko, Chuan‐Min Yen and Ya‐Lei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Infectious Diseases, Transfusion and Tropical Medicine & International Health.
